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Wraysbury to Torquay start from as little as £33.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Wraysbury to Torquay start from £61.60 one way, or £107.00 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Wraysbury to Torquay are available for £149.50 one way, or £299.00 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

Even though Wraysbury Station might not have the hustle and bustle of a city terminal, it offers all the essentials to ensure a smooth journey. While there is no staffed ticket office, ticket machines are conveniently available, making it easy to collect your tickets. Additionally, these machines are accessible and equipped to handle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ring that all travelers can navigate the station with ease.

For assistance, the station has help points rather than staffed desks, and there's CCTV for added security. The station offers step-free access from separate entrances, with a reasonably accessible route between platforms, making it more navigable for those with mobility aids.

There are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ities available, so you might want to plan ahead to bring your snacks or grab a coffee before heading to the station. Bicycle enthusiasts will find rack spaces on Platform 1 and rest assured, your bike will be safe under the watchful eyes of the station’s CCTV.

Transport Connections

Wraysbury Station’s connections with other modes of transport enhance its convenience for travelers. Although there is no direct taxi service or bicycle hire facilities, the station is well-served by local buses. If rail services are disrupted, replacement services provide smooth connections to nearby destinations such as Staines and Windsor. Facilities at Torquay Station

The station is equipped with a range of facilities designed to make your journey as comfortable and easy as possible. Ticket buying and collection are straightforward with both a ticket office and machines available. Accessibility is a key focus with step-free access provided in parts and ramps available for train access. While the station does not have a luggage storage facility, it excels in providing essential services like CCTV for security and a help point for customer information. For those relying on the digital world, while Wi-Fi isn't available, pay phones are on hand if you need to make a call.

And if you're peckish or fancy a caffeine boost, there's a coffee shop right on site. However, note that while smartcards can be issued, there are no smartcard validators, and for the currency-conscious, no ATMs or currency exchange services are available.

Accessibility and Support

Torquay Train Station aims to ensure that everyone can access rail services confidently. This is achieved through features such as step-free access to all platforms, acc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and a designated set-down/pick-up point for those with impaired mobility. While there are no accessible toilets, assistance can still be arranged by contacting the helpline in advance via Passenger Assist.

Transport Links and Onward Travel

When it comes to onward travel, the station connects smoothly with various other forms of transport. If you're thinking about continuing your journey by bus, printed information for planning your trip is readily available (here). Taxis are readily accessible just outside the station, and for those looking to hire a vehicle, there's a Thrifty Car hire service right adjacent to platform 1. Bicycle hire might be less accessible, with limited storage and no shelter, but the station ensures there are standards for bike parking if needed.
